Played at Marshall for 3 seasons (Conference USA Freshman of the Year, 2x 2nd Team All Conference). Grad transferred to Iowa State and was a 3rd Team All American (1st Team All Big 12). He went undrafted but has had a solid overseas career. Kane was a contributer for 3 of Overseas Elite's championships.

Here are some clips from his time in Isreal...

From Wiki...
"In TBT 2016, Kane averaged 9.2 PPG and 4.0 RPG as Overseas Elite took home the $2 million prize. In TBT 2017, Kane averaged 9.3 PPG and 3.3 RPG as Overseas Elite successfully defended their title, defeating Team Challenge ALS in the championship game, 86–83. In TBT 2018, Kane averaged 6.0 PPG and 3.3 RPG on 54 percent shooting. Overseas Elite reached the championship game and defeated Eberlein Drive, 70–58, again claiming the $2 million prize. In TBT 2019, Kane and Overseas Elite advanced to the semifinals where they suffered their first-ever defeat, losing to Carmen's Crew, 71–66."
